VICI Properties Inc. (NYSE:VICI) Shares Purchased by Wells Fargo & Company MN

Wells Fargo & Company MN increased its position in shares of VICI Properties Inc. (NYSE:VICIFree Report) by 0.4%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 1,300,707 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 4,767 shares during the period. Wells Fargo & Company MN owned 0.12% of VICI Properties worth $37,994,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

VICI Properties Trading Down 2.3 %

Shares of VICI Properties stock opened at $30.09 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 2.61, a current ratio of 2.61 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.63. The company’s 50-day simple moving average is $31.37 and its 200-day simple moving average is $31.18. VICI Properties Inc. has a 52-week low of $27.08 and a 52-week high of $34.29. The firm has a market cap of $31.79 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 11.75,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.88 and a beta of 0.70.

VICI Properties (NYSE:VICIG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, February 20th. The company reported $0.57 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.67 by ($0.10). VICI Properties had a return on equity of 10.24% and a net margin of 69.59%. The company had revenue of $976.05 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$969.29 million.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that VICI Properties Inc. will post 2.31 earnings per share for the current year.

VICI Properties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, April 3rd. Stockholders of record on Thursday, March 20th were given a $0.4325 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, March 20th. This represents a $1.73 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 5.75%. VICI Properties’s dividend payout ratio is presently 67.58%.

About VICI Properties

(Free Report)

VICI Properties Inc is an S&P 500 experiential real estate investment trust that owns one of the largest portfolios of market-leading gaming, hospitality and entertainment destinations, including Caesars Palace Las Vegas, MGM Grand and the Venetian Resort Las Vegas, three of the most iconic entertainment facilities on the Las Vegas Strip.
